My middle school had a lot of teachers that were WW2 veterans. Our assistant dean, Henry Hauser was a medic at Bastogne. My basketball coach Richard Tosky, was a marine wounded at Iwo Jima. One time he showed us his scar. My history teacher, Gordon Teichmann was a Marine and fought in the Pacific. By the time we hit middle school, they were towards the end of their careers.
Each of them touched my life in a different way. I am grateful for that, and for their service.
